Why is Surface Treatment Necessary?

The PCB surface treatment process is crucial to ensuring solderability, oxidation resistance, and long-term reliability of printed circuit boards. Without proper treatment, PCB surfaces can corrode, affecting performance and durability.

Step-by-Step Surface Treatment Process

1. Cleaning the PCB Surface

  • Removes contaminants such as dust, oil, and oxidation.
  • Ensures a smooth and clean base for the finishing process.

2. Applying a Surface Finish

  • A protective layer is added to enhance solderability and durability.
  • The choice of finish depends on cost, application, and environmental factors.

Common Surface Treatment Methods

  • HASL (Hot Air Solder Leveling) – Cost-effective but uneven.
  • ENIG (Electroless Nickel Immersion Gold) – Excellent for fine-pitch components.
  • OSP (Organic Solderability Preservative) – Environmentally friendly but less durable.
  • Immersion Silver – Good conductivity but prone to tarnishing.

Final Inspection and Quality Control

  • Checks for uniform coating, solderability, and defects.
  • Ensures compliance with industry standards.

A well-applied PCB surface finish improves performance, reliability, and longevity, making it a crucial step in PCB manufacturing.
